In today's digital age, having an online presence is crucial for businesses and individuals alike. Creating a website is an essential step towards establishing this presence, and two key elements that play a significant role in website setup are domain and hosting. In this article, we will delve into the concept of domain and hosting, exploring their definitions, functions, and how they work together to bring a website to life.
What is a Domain?
Definition of a Domain
A domain refers to the unique address of a website on the internet. It acts as an online identity, allowing users to access a website using a recognizable and memorable name instead of a string of numbers known as an IP address. For example, "www.example.com" is a domain name.
Components of a Domain Name
A domain name comprises several parts, each serving a specific purpose. The most common structure consists of three components:
Top-Level Domain (TLD): This is the last part of a domain name, such as ".com," ".org," or ".net." TLDs can indicate the nature of the website or the geographic location it represents.
Second-Level Domain (SLD): The SLD is the core part of the domain name and is placed before the TLD. It represents the main identity of the website and is often associated with the brand or organization.
Subdomain: Subdomains are optional and are added before the SLD. They are used to create additional sections or divisions within a website.
To own a domain, it must be registered through a domain registrar. The registration process involves checking the availability of the desired domain name and paying a registration fee. It is essential to choose a domain name that aligns with your brand or website's purpose and is easy for users to remember.
What is Hosting?
Definition of Hosting
Web hosting refers to the service that allows websites to be accessible on the internet. It involves storing website files, data, and content on a server that is connected to the internet. When users type a domain name into their browser, the hosting server delivers the website's files, allowing it to be displayed on their screens.
Shared Hosting: In shared hosting, multiple websites are hosted on a single server, sharing its resources. It is an affordable option suitable for small to medium-sized websites with moderate traffic.
VPS Hosting: Virtual Private Server (VPS) hosting provides a dedicated portion of a server with virtualized resources. It offers more control, scalability, and performance than shared hosting.
Dedicated Hosting: With dedicated hosting, an entire physical server is allocated to a single website. It provides maximum control, customization, and resources, making it ideal for large websites with high traffic.
Cloud Hosting: Cloud hosting utilizes a network of interconnected servers to host websites. It offers scalability, flexibility, and reliability by distributing resources across multiple servers.
How Domain and Hosting Work Together
Domain and hosting work hand in hand to bring a website online. When a user enters a domain name into their browser, the domain is translated into an IP address through a process called
Domain Name System (DNS) resolution. This IP address then directs the user's request to the hosting server associated with that domain. The hosting server retrieves the website files and delivers them to the user's browser, allowing them to view the website.
Choosing the Right Domain and Hosting Provider
Selecting the right domain and hosting provider is crucial for the success of your website. Here are some factors to consider:
Reliability and Uptime: Ensure that the provider has a reputation for reliable and stable hosting services, with minimal downtime.
Scalability: Consider the growth potential of your website and choose a provider that can accommodate future expansion.
Security: Look for hosting providers that offer robust security measures, such as SSL certificates, firewalls, and regular backups, to protect your website and sensitive data.
Support: Opt for a provider that offers responsive customer support to address any technical issues or concerns promptly.
Tips for Domain and Hosting Management
To ensure smooth operation and management of your domain and hosting, keep the following tips in mind:
Domain Renewal
Stay proactive with domain renewal to prevent expiration. Set up reminders or enable auto-renewal options to avoid losing your domain name.
Security and Privacy
Implement security measures like domain privacy protection to safeguard personal information associated with your domain and protect against unauthorized access
Website Backup
Regularly back up your website files and databases to a secure location or use hosting providers that offer automated backup services. This helps in case of accidental data loss or website issues.
FAQs
1. How do I choose a domain name?
When choosing a domain name, consider a name that is relevant to your website's purpose, easy to remember, and reflects your brand or organization.
2. Can I transfer my domain to another registrar?
Yes, domain transfers are possible. However, the process may vary depending on the domain registrar you are transferring from and the one you are transferring to.
3. Can I change my hosting provider later?
Yes, it is possible to switch hosting providers. However, it may involve migrating your website files and databases to the new hosting environment, which requires technical expertise or assistance.
4. What is the difference between a domain and a subdomain?
A domain is the primary address of a website, while a subdomain is an extension of the main domain. For example, "www.example.com" is a domain, while "blog.example.com" is a subdomain. Subdomains can be used to create separate sections or websites within the main domain.
5. Do I need technical knowledge to manage my domain and hosting?
While technical knowledge can be helpful, it is not always necessary. Many domain and hosting providers offer user-friendly interfaces and tools to manage your website, including domain settings, email accounts, and website backups. Additionally, customer support is available to assist you with any technical questions or issues.
More From Author
Website Design